I took Clomid for approx. 6 cycles and had insomnia, night sweats, terrible mood swings - I think that was all (sorry it was a while ago). Unfortunately no BFP for me on Clomid, even though blood test confirmed O.
I didn't have any emotional symptoms that I could put down to clomid. I was a bit emotional but that was probably TTC and not clomid. I think clomid made me a bit excited that I was doing something. I took the medication before bed so I could sleep through any side effects. The side effects I had were physical. My ovaries close to ovulation felt like I had a marble in there, but again I felt positive about it as I felt like my body was doing what it was supposed to be doing. The really negative side effect I had which ended my time on clomid was it dried up my CM to the point I was in a lot of discomfort. I think it can dry you up a little but it was an issue how dry I became. Due to this issue I was swapped onto FSH.
Overall, I would definitely give clomid again if I was to do it all again. All the emotional things I read about didn't happen to me.
